Specifications
Series: OMF 125
Packaging: Tape & Reel (TR) 
Lead Free Status / RoHS Status: --
Part Status: Active
Fuse Type: Board Mount (Cartridge Style Excluded)
Current Rating: 750mA
Voltage Rating - AC: 125V
Voltage Rating - DC: 125V
Response Time: Fast
Package / Case: 2-SMD, J-Lead
Mounting Type: Surface Mount
Breaking Capacity @ Rated Voltage: 100A
Melting I²t: 0.031
Approvals: cURus
Operating Temperature: -55°C ~ 125°C
Color: --
Size / Dimension: 0.291" L x 0.122" W x 0.102" H (7.40mm x 3.10mm x 2.60mm)
